Subject: 1998 Kia Sephia Kamakaze!

Yesterday (1/11/06), my 1998 Kia Sephia LS model caught on fire and burned to the ground. I had just hit 90,000 miles on it, and there was no warning that anything was wrong. I had just bought new tires and new spark plugs, and was seemingly running like a dream until all of a sudden the cab filled with smoke, my breaks wouldn't work, and by the time I unstrapped myself and got out of the car, the whole engine bay was in flames. From what I was told by the car people, the break lines busted and sprayed the engine... a small spark caused it to burn, and very rapidly. I was lucky I could pull over and stop before it made it to the driver seat!
Sure, the darn thing was paid for (that's why I bought it... cheap and low maintenance) but was it worth it? I could have died!!! I am 32 weeks pregnant, and I had to go to the hospital afterwards. Luckily, the baby is okay, but now I have to buy a new car with no tradein.
